Caterham School believe that this statement defines the essence of the school.
Headmaster Julian Thomas said: “We believe that a truly excellent education is about more than academic achievement alone. We are a forward thinking school that focuses on developing the whole person, aiming to ensure that each pupil leaves here ready for life at university and beyond. “We do not simply prepare pupils to do their best in exams, we help each pupil to understand how to think independently. We train pupils in information skills so that they understand how to make best use of reading skills and research techniques.“ Caterham School has a reputation for excellent academic results. All students progress to university with 83% going to one in the top tier including Oxford, Cambridge, Imperial College, LSE and UCL. As a day and boarding school, a wide range of enrichment and co- curricular activities are on offer, enabling students to develop their skills and interests. There are around forty clubs and societies, eighteen sports and twenty different music groups. There is continued investment in the future. In 2006, a new science block and dining hall was built and in 2008 the new, well equipped Sixth Form Centre was completed.
